How much do controls engineer project manager j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 13, 2026, the average yearly pay for controls engineer project manager in Souderton, PA is $108,088.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$87,800.00 and $130,200.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a controls engineer project manager?

A Controls Engineer Project Manager is a professional who oversees the design, implementation, and management of automation and control systems within projects. They combine technical expertise in controls engineering—such as programming PLCs, designing control panels, and integrating industrial systems—with project management skills like budgeting, scheduling, and team coordination. Their role ensures that automation projects are completed safely, on time, and within budget, while meeting all technical and quality standards. They often act as the main point of contact between clients, engineers, and other stakeholders.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a controls engineer project manager?

To thrive as a Controls Engineer Project Manager, you need a strong background in electrical engineering, automation systems, and project management, typically supported by a relevant engineering degree and PMP certification. Familiarity with PLC programming, SCADA systems, AutoCAD, and project management software such as MS Project is commonly required. Excellent leadership, problem-solving, and communication skills help drive teams, manage stakeholders, and ensure project delivery. These skills and qualifications are vital for overseeing complex automation projects, maintaining technical standards, and achieving project goals on time and within budget.

How does a controls engineer project manager typically collaborate with cross-functional teams during project execution?

A Controls Engineer Project Manager frequently works alongside electrical engineers, software developers, mechanical engineers, and project stakeholders to ensure that control systems meet project requirements and deadlines. Collaboration often involves organizing regular meetings, facilitating clear communication of technical specifications, and addressing integration challenges between different system components. Strong teamwork and leadership skills are essential, as the Project Manager must coordinate tasks, resolve conflicts, and ensure all team members are aligned toward project goals. This collaborative environment fosters innovation and helps maintain project timelines and quality standards.

Senior Controls Engineer

We're seeking a full-time controls engineer to join our expanding team and contribute to the design, programming, and management of automation projects in the pharmaceutical and food & beverage industries. LAPORTE is a consulting engineering firm which has been in business for 25 years. Today, the company has 25 offices across North America and Europe, and over 480 employees with a passion for engineering.

Join us for a competitive salary, compensatory PTO, comprehensive benefits, and a supportive work environment that emphasizes professional growth. We believe in a flexible working environment that values work-life balance while encouraging efficiency and creativity on a daily basis.

The Controls Engineer will:

  • Lead and support the design of automation projects, developing specifications for control panels, networks, and software (primarily Allen-Bradley PLC/PACs and Factorytalk View ME/SE HMI and SCADA).
  • Translate process or packaging applications into detailed construction packages for control panel designs and electrical installation scopes. Construction packages typical include equipment arrangement drawings, schematics, wiring diagrams, cable schedules, control panel drawings, etc.
  • Mentor and supervise project team members, enhancing team collaboration and project execution.
  • Provide comprehensive lifecycle support for projects, including system design, troubleshooting, testing, and commissioning.
  • Perform site surveys and offer hands-on support during installation, focusing on control system deployment.
  • Adhere to and ensure compliance with relevant codes (UL508A, NEC) and standards.
  • Engage in diverse projects, enhancing your engineering and project management skills.
  • Travel expectations are dependent on specific project requirements by typically require 1-3 days for an initial site visit and then a return trip to lead commissioning efforts which may take 1-4 weeks. Overall travel is anticipated to be 20-40%.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in chemical eng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Electrical Engineering, or Electrical Engineering Technology.
  • 6+ years of experience in control systems, manufacturing, or consulting-design environments including experience commissioning systems, preferably as a lead.
  • Proficient in automation project tasks including design, client coordination, and bid package preparation.
  • Skilled in control panel and network design, instrument selection, and control system programming.
  • Proficiency with AutoCAD for control panel design and electrical construction packages.
  • Familiarity / Experience with electrical engineering construction packages - single line diagrams, panel schedules, power plans, etc.
  • Hands-on experience surveying existing control installations and preparing as-built conditions of systems.
  • Experience surveying and planning control systems projects without support of a manager.
  • Hands-on experience with Rockwell Automation software-Studio 5000 / RSLogix 5000 for PLC programming and FactoryTalk View ME / SE for HMI and SCADA development.
